Michael Polk to Retire as CEO of Newell Brands
Michael Polk, who has been at the helm of Newell Brands since 2011, announced his retirement set
for the end of the second quarter. Michael Polk Newell Brands has been instrumental in steering Newell Brands through an ambitious
Accelerated Transformation Plan, positioning the company as a prominent player in the global consumer goods sector.
Under Polk’s leadership, Newell Brands has cultivated a diverse portfolio that includes
renowned names like Paper Mate® and Sharpie®. His tenure was marked by
strategic shifts aimed at enhancing the company’s innovation, design, and eCommerce capabilities.
The Newell Brands Board has initiated a comprehensive search for the
incoming CEO, enlisting Heidrick & Struggles, a notable executive search
firm, to ensure a seamless transition. Patrick Campbell, the Chairman of the
Board, expressed gratitude for Polk’s contributions, acknowledging the transformational strides made during his leadership.
Michael Polk Newell Brands remarked on his departure, emphasizing his
pride in the progress achieved since he took over. He remains committed to
facilitating a smooth transition for his successor.
